背景情况:
- 泰勒圆对于稳定的圆喷射电旋至关重要,影响喷射稳定性和滴滴大小.
- 了解泰勒圆动力学是控制电过程的关键.
研究的目的:
- 研究泰勒的形态,长度和角度.
- 分析操作参数和液体特性对泰勒形动态的影响.
主要方法:
- 泰勒形态学的实验调查.
- 泰勒形行为的数值模拟.
- 电势,流速,表面张力,导电能力和粘度的系统变化.
主要成果:
- 增加的电位将圆从凸变为,长度减小,角度增加.
- 较高的流量率导致凸的形,长度增加,角度减少.
- 较低的表面张力促进形圆;较高的表面张力有利于形圆.
- 高导电性转换圆从形到凸形,增加电流.
- 粘度保持一个直线的圆,增加长度和喷射半径.
结论:
- 操作参数和液体特性显著影响泰勒形态和喷气特性.
- 控制泰勒圆动力学允许精确操纵电旋中的喷气和滴滴形成.

Fluid mechanics model studies often utilize scaled-down systems to predict fluid behavior in full-scale environments, such as river flows, dam spillways, and structures interacting with open surfaces. Maintaining Froude number similarity in river models is crucial, as it replicates surface flow features like wave patterns and velocities.

Scaled hydraulic models of dam spillways provide a practical way to replicate and study the intricate flow dynamics of these structures. Often built to a 1:15 ratio, these models allow for observing critical water behavior, such as velocity distribution, flow patterns, and energy dissipation.

The principle of conservation of mass is fundamental in fluid dynamics and is crucial for analyzing flow within fixed control volumes, such as pipes or ducts. This principle states that the total mass within a control volume remains constant unless altered by the inflow or outflow of mass through the control surfaces. This results in a vital relationship for steady, incompressible flow where the mass entering a system equals the mass leaving it.

The principle of conservation of mass is a fundamental law in fluid mechanics and is applied using the continuity equation. We apply the concept to a finite control volume to derive the continuity equation.
A system is defined as a collection of unchanging contents, and the conservation of mass states that a system's mass is constant.
